HP Announces Summer Release of Three New Printers

June 21, 2007* – HP rolled out their summer line of products today, including nine new digital cameras and three inkjet printers. Two new photo printers, the HP Photosmart D7260 and Photosmart D7460, utilize six-cartridge, Vivera inks and feature a large, 3.5" display screen. The Photosmart C5280 All-in-One printer features print, copy, and scan capabilities, and it comes standard with one black and one tricolor cartridge. Users can choose to purchase a six-ink color cartridge and gray cartridge for enhanced photo printing. The D7260 and the D7460 sell for $149 and $179, respectively, and will be available in August 2007. The C5280 All-in-One will be available this month and sell for $149. HP’s new photo printers, the Photosmart D7260 and D7460, can print at fast speeds—34 pages per minute (ppm) for black text and 33 ppm for color. Photos can print as quickly as ten seconds. Both printers feature memory card slots and Ethernet connectivity, while the D7460 ramps it up with wireless capabilities. 

Other features of the D7260 and D7460 printers include HP’s Red-eye Removal button and a new Smart Web Printing feature that allows printing of web pages without the cutoff edges. Color inks are available for $9.99, and the black ink cartridge sells for $17.99. The HP 02 Value Pack includes all six inks and 150 sheets of paper for only $35.99.  The Photosmart C5280 All-in-One printer prints and copies documents as fast as 32 ppm black and 24 ppm color, with 4" x 6" photos printing in as little as 27 seconds. The All-in-One’s scanner is capable of 48-bit, 4800 x 4800 dpi scans.  Automated features on the C5280, such as the auto paper-type sensor and automatically engaging photo paper tray, make printing easier. A 2.4" LCD display and media card slots enable printing directly from the printer. The printer can also print directly onto CDs and DVDs. While the C5280 ships with one 74 black and one 75 tricolor ink cartridge, printing quality can be expanded by purchasing the optional 99 six-ink color cartridge and 100 gray photo cartridge. HP’s new high capacity XL cartridges are also available for this all-in-one printer.
